------- Additional Comments From t.i.m at zen.co.uk 2004-12-16 16:15 -------
With this patch people can still drop plugins in their home directory, they
only have to specify the --user-registry command line option. The 0.001% of
people who need this will find about it in a second from the man page and are
unlikely to have a problem with this.
What this patch solves is the common
<a> did you run gst-register?
<b> yes, but it still doesn't work
<a> did you run it as root?
<b> no, I didn't. Now it says 'wrote
registry /root/.gstreamer-0.8/registry.xml'
... further confusion ...
as witnessed multiple times on IRC.
I am not arguing this is something that really really is a problem and needs
to be applied, but I do think this is an improvement. The improvement is that
it enables people to help themselves and do the right thing by themselves
through the warning message.
Finally, the 'Rebuilding user registry /root/.gstreamer-0.8/registry.xml' (or
similar) message when you run gst-register as root is simply confusing and
should be dropped completely IMHO. There is no good reason why the root user
needs to drop plugins into his home directory either as far as I can see.
